Mukunda Prasad Das (born 4 January 1945) is an Indian-born Australian physicist at the Australian National University.
He was elected a Fellow of the American Physical Society[1][2] after he was nominated by their Forum on International Physics in 2003,[3] for notable theoretical investigations in condensed matter physics, namely: mesoscopic transport and noise, high temperature superconductivity and density functional theory; and for significant leadership in promoting international meetings and collaborations.
